Why Certification Matters for Renovation Leads

Renovation projects can stall quickly when the risks of lead exposure are underestimated. Contractors may face compliance issues, unexpected remediation costs, or delays caused by improper preparation of work areas. Homeowners and property managers also expect trained professionals who understand how to Lead Renovator Certification control dust, handle unsafe materials, and document the steps taken to protect occupants. Without the right credentials, even skilled remodelers can struggle to prove readiness for lead-related work, which can limit job opportunities and increase liability.
